    Campos is a smaller catcher with a 5-foot-9, 180-pound frame but excellent zone control and bat-to-ball skills that make his profile similar to 2023 Maryland sixth-rounder Luke Shliger. In three years with Arizona State, Campos has hit .367/.463/.552 with 21 home runs, a 9.8% strikeout rate and a 13.9% walk rate. What he lacks in power he makes up for with a standout offensive approach that takes advantage of his shorter stature. Campos doesn’t often expand the zone and is happy to take his walks when he gets them, and when pitchers do come in the zone and Campos decides to swing, he doesn’t miss. His in-zone contact rate for his career is an impressive 91% and he employs a compact and direct lefthanded swing that allows him to slap the ball on a line to all fields. He’s unlikely to ever hit more than 10 homers in a full pro season despite improvement in his home run production year-over-year in college, and he also had two underwhelming summers in the Cape Cod League with Wareham. Campos moves well behind the plate and has a chance for solid receiving skills. He gets rid of the ball quickly on his throws which might help compensate for below-average pure arm strength.
